Cost of Kitchen Drain Installation in Brighton

Installing a kitchen drain in Brighton, CO can vary in cost depending on several factors. Whether you're renovating your kitchen or building a new home, understanding the potential expenses involved can help you budget effectively. Here, we explore the elements that influence the cost and provide a detailed breakdown of common tasks and their average costs.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Type of Drain: Different types of drains, such as standard, garbage disposal-compatible, or high-end designer drains, can significantly influence the cost.
  • Material: The choice of materials, including PVC, stainless steel, or cast iron, impacts the overall expense.
  • Labor Rates: Labor costs can vary based on the expertise and experience of the plumber, as well as the complexity of the installation.
  • Permits and Inspections: Depending on local regulations, permits and inspections may be required, adding to the overall cost.
  • Existing Plumbing Condition: If the existing plumbing is outdated or requires repairs, this can increase the cost of installation.
  • Accessibility: The ease of access to the installation site can affect labor time and cost.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Brighton, CO)
Standard Drain Installation $200 - $400
Garbage Disposal Installation $250 - $500
High-End Designer Drain $400 - $800
PVC Pipe Installation $100 - $300
Stainless Steel Pipe Installation $300 - $600
Cast Iron Pipe Installation $500 - $1,000
Labor per Hour $50 - $100
Permit and Inspection Fees $50 - $150
Plumbing Repair (per hour) $75 - $150
